The 5G Chipset Market was valued at USD 36.88 billion in 2023, expected to reach USD 44.88 billion in 2024, and is projected to grow at a CAGR of 22.97%, to USD 156.90 billion by 2030.

The scope of the 5G chipset market is expansive, driven by its critical role in enabling the next generation of mobile networks, which promise significantly faster data speeds, higher capacity, and lower latency. These chipsets are essential for supporting the connectivity needs of diverse applications such as smartphones, IoT devices, autonomous vehicles, and smart cities. The market is segmented by component, type, end-use, and application, serving the telecommunications, automotive, healthcare, and industrial sectors. Key growth factors include the increasing demand for high-speed internet, the proliferation of connected devices, and the ongoing digital transformation across various industries. Governments worldwide are investing in 5G infrastructure, thereby amplifying market opportunities. Additionally, advancements in AI and machine learning further enhance the capabilities of 5G chipsets, providing new avenues for application and development. However, challenges include high costs of development, compatibility issues with existing infrastructure, and security concerns that may hinder the rapid adoption of 5G technology. Market growth is also tempered by geopolitical tensions affecting semiconductor supply chains. To capitalize on emerging opportunities, companies should focus on developing energy-efficient, cost-effective chipsets tailored for specific industry needs such as automated industrial processes or smart healthcare applications. Investment in R&D for novel materials and chip designs, alongside collaboration with telecom operators and other sectors, can unlock new market potential. The 5G chipset market remains highly competitive, with innovation being key to maintaining a leading position. As the ecosystem evolves, convergence with emerging technologies like AI, IoT, and edge computing will be crucial. Companies that can effectively integrate these technologies into their chipsets are likely to thrive, as they will be foundational to supporting a wide array of future smart applications.

Key Company Profiles

The report delves into recent significant developments in the 5G Chipset Market, highlighting leading vendors and their innovative profiles. These include Analog Devices, Inc., Anokiwave Inc., Arm Limited, Broadcom Inc., Fibocom Wireless Inc., Hi-Silicon by Huawei Technologies Co., Ltd., Infineon Technologies AG by Intel Corporation, Keysight Technologies, MACOM Technology Solutions Inc., Marvell Technology, Inc., MaxLinear, Inc., MediaTek Inc., Murata Electronics North America, Inc., Nokia Corporation, NXP Semiconductors N.V., Qorvo, Inc., Qualcomm Technologies, Inc., Renesas Electronics Corporation, Samsung Electronics Co., Ltd., Silicon Labs, Sony Semiconductor Solutions Corporation, STMicroelectronics International N.V., Telefonaktiebolaget LM Ericsson, u-blox AG, Unisoc (Shanghai) Technologies Co., Ltd., Xilinx Inc. by Advanced Micro Devices, Inc., and Yole Group.
